Ultraman Max (ウルトラマンマックス,   Urutoraman Makkusu) is a tokusatsu Kyodai Hero television series produced by Tsuburaya Productions and is the nineteenth entry of the Ultraman Series. It ran on Chubu-Nippon Broadcasting from July 2, 2005 to April 1, 2006.

Trivia[]

  • Rather than only introducing new monsters and having a darker tone like the previous series, Ultraman Nexus, Ultraman Max was given a lighter tone and featured old and new monsters appearing in its episodes.
